    Since my first response was a useless smart-@$$ reply, I thought I'd try again to be more helpful. Did you see these old threads on ARFcom when you were googling around?



    Sounds like the same stuff. 60-rd boxes, 77 headstamp vs your 71 (maybe yours is also 77?). Seems to be fairly high quality, according to those guys. And they say SS92 is the FN term for M193, 55gr bullet.
